Obscure shooters have shot dead Samson Sedi, a pioneer of the All Progressives Congress, APC, in the Etsako West Local Government Area of Edo state.
Sedi, the adolescent pioneer of the APC in the zone, was killed in Jattu on Wednesday.
The Commissioner of Police in the state, Johnson Kokumo, affirmed the occurrence to Punch yesterday.
Kokumo said that the episode was being examined as an instance of murder as the casualty was not seized of his things.
The police official stated, "We are examining a murder case. We are not researching furnished theft. No one was seized in this specific case.
"In this way, what we are examining is kill and not outfitted theft. We have gotten things under way. Our men are out there and I guarantee you that, with knowledge drove policing, we will soon convey the guilty parties to book."
The State Governor Godwin Obaseki, denounced the executing, depicting it as "stunning."
Obaseki, in an announcement by his Special Adviser on Media and Communication Strategy, Crusoe Osagie, additionally requested the capture and indictment of the executioners.
